We are currently seeking a Financial Analyst to work in our accounting department as an internal controls specialist. The successful candidate will be a self-starter with strong analytical, communication, and interpersonal skills along with a passion for learning.  

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:

The successful candidate will assist the company’s internal controls over financial reporting program as part of the annual regulatory compliance requirements. The individual will require an understanding of various oil and gas general accounting processes and procedures, including production, revenue, royalties, marketing arrangements, expenditure accounting, and financial reporting. Responsibilities include:

  • Support and coordinate ARC’s annual assessment of internal controls over financial reporting as stipulated by National Instrument 52-109
  • Contribute to the annual risk assessment and analysis of the financial statements and controls to determine the scope of the internal controls program
  • Act as the key liaison with a third-party service provider to plan and perform detailed accounting process walk-throughs and control test procedures
  • Assist IT business leaders with the planning and execution of their internal controls program as it relates to ICFR
  • Communicate deficiencies as well as develop and implement remediation plans to address deficiencies
  • Provide internal advisory related to internal control design, process efficiency, and effectiveness
  • Develop and manage relationships with business stakeholders, third party advisors, and the company’s external auditors
  • Maintain and enhance documentation of internal controls in support of the assessment
  • Keep informed of SEC, IFRS, and other regulations and provide and technical guidance as it pertains to internal controls and other related activities
  • Advance the use of ARC’s ICFR software platform to enable robust analysis and reporting
  • Lead or assist internal control projects and in the development and implementation of new Finance & Accounting policies and/or amendment of existing policies from time to time

Q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Bachelor’s degree in accounting, business or a related discipline and a CPA designation
  • A minimum of 3 years of public accounting and/or related oil & gas industry experience
  • Experience in assessing the design and operating effectiveness of internal controls over financial reporting would be considered an asset but not required
  • Proven analytical and quantitative skills
  • Strong work ethic and ability to work within tight deadlines
